Syria Says Withdrawing Troops After Agreeing To Ceasefire In SweidaSyria announced it had begun withdrawing its army from Druze-majority Sweida city on Wednesday night after agreeing to a new ceasefire that it said would bring a complete halt to its military operations there.
The Israel Defense Forces on Wednesday attacked the entrance to the Syrian regime’s military headquarters in the Damascus area in response to reports of atrocities against local Druze residents.
Dozens of wounded and dead arrived at a hospital in Al-Mazraa in Syria's southern Sweida province on Tuesday following clashes between local militias, clans and government forces.
Following a dramatic Israeli airstrike on Syria’s General Staff Headquarters in Damascus, U.S. Senator Marco Rubio called the escalation a “misunderstanding” and claimed de-escalation could be just hours away.
The Syrian presidency vowed to punish those who committed violations against Druze-majority Sweida's residents, as government forces were accused of summary executions and other abuses by right groups,
